New B2 beta 05 build 170.
64-bit/32-bit VST on Win. 32-bit RTAS on Win.
64-bit/32-bit AU & VST on OSX.
This beta fixes:
1) Problems with switching OS and interpolation modes that could result in muted outputs in bounces on OSX (and maybe Win?)
2) Problems with saving Author Name and Author Info preferences on the Info page.
Once again, there are now no remaining known issues. We appreciate all your help in pointing us to anything else that we may have missed. If you point it out now, it will be fixed immediately. Speak now...
Note this is only for AU & VST on OSX. If you need RTAS in addition to VST/AU, do NOT install this yet. This version is NOT compatible with the previous version RTAS shells. We are looking at AAX now to see how long it will take to add. We do NOT anticipate offering an RTAS version of B2 1.1.0 or any future versions of B2 or any other 2CAudio product. RTAS development will be suspended. It will be replaced with AAX. RTAS uses can continue with the current versions of our products and we will provide a special legacy version of the plug with a different ID so that you can install the old RTAS and the new versions concurrently if really necessary. This will be available on a per-request basis.

Another note: B2 1.1.0 and all subsequent products and updates no longer support Windows XP. We can offer special builds of these products for Win XP on a per-request basis, but they are not officially supported and we can not troubleshoot in any way as we no longer have Windows XP to test on. This is in line with most current version host applications. If you still use Windows XP for some reason, you might consider sticking with the current/previous generation of our products until you switch to Windows 7/8.
